Web Application Security Checklist 2025: Protect Your Business from Cyber Threats
Introduction – Security Threats in 2025
Modern businesses rely heavily on web applications for ecommerce, enterprise operations, SaaS platforms, mobile integrations, and customer engagement. As digital transformation accelerates, cyber threats are becoming more sophisticated, automated, and financially damaging.
The growing importance of a strong web application security checklist 2025 reflects the urgent need for businesses to secure applications against evolving attack vectors, ransomware campaigns, API exploits, and AI-driven cyberattacks.
Modern attackers target vulnerabilities across frontend systems, backend infrastructure, APIs, authentication mechanisms, cloud environments, and third-party integrations. Even small security weaknesses can result in major data breaches, financial losses, operational disruption, and reputational damage.
Organizations implementing strong web security best practices gain significant advantages through improved customer trust, regulatory compliance, and operational resilience.
Developer Infotech helps businesses build secure digital ecosystems through Web Development, Laravel Development, Mobile App Development, AI Solutions, Shopify Development, and Custom Software Development services designed with modern cybersecurity principles and scalable protection strategies.

OWASP Top 10 2025
The owasp top 10 2025 continues to serve as one of the most important frameworks for identifying critical web application vulnerabilities.
Organizations implementing secure development practices should prioritize protection against these major security risks.
― Broken Access Control
Broken access control vulnerabilities allow unauthorized users to access restricted systems, resources, or sensitive data.
Improper permission validation can expose administrative functions, customer records, and internal business operations.
Role-based access control, least privilege principles, and centralized authorization management help reduce these risks significantly.
― Cryptographic Failures
Weak encryption practices remain one of the leading causes of sensitive data exposure.
Applications must encrypt sensitive information both in transit and at rest using modern cryptographic standards.
Poor key management and outdated encryption algorithms create major security weaknesses.
― Injection Attacks
Injection vulnerabilities occur when untrusted input is executed as commands or queries.
SQL injection, command injection, and NoSQL injection attacks remain highly dangerous in modern applications.
Strong input validation, parameterized queries, and ORM frameworks help reduce injection-related vulnerabilities.
― Insecure Design
Security should be integrated directly into application architecture rather than treated as an afterthought.
Poor security planning often creates systemic weaknesses that cannot be fixed easily later.
Modern secure development lifecycles focus heavily on threat modeling and proactive risk assessment.
― Security Misconfiguration
Misconfigured servers, APIs, cloud infrastructure, and security settings create major attack surfaces.
Organizations should regularly review security policies, disable unnecessary services, and automate configuration validation.
Cloud-native environments especially require strong configuration management practices.
― Vulnerable and Outdated Components
Modern applications rely heavily on third-party libraries, frameworks, and open-source dependencies.
Outdated software components often contain publicly known vulnerabilities actively targeted by attackers.
Dependency scanning and automated update management are critical parts of modern secure coding practices.
― Identification and Authentication Failures
Weak authentication systems increase the risk of account compromise and credential theft.
Applications should implement multi-factor authentication, secure password policies, and session management protections.
Authentication workflows must also protect against brute force attacks and credential stuffing.
― Software and Data Integrity Failures
Applications must verify the integrity of software updates, dependencies, APIs, and deployment pipelines.
Unsigned code deployments and insecure CI/CD workflows create opportunities for supply chain attacks.
Modern DevSecOps strategies integrate integrity verification directly into software delivery pipelines.
― Security Logging and Monitoring Failures
Poor visibility into application activity delays incident detection and response.
Organizations should implement centralized logging, threat monitoring, anomaly detection, and real-time alerting systems.
Comprehensive observability improves security operations and incident response efficiency.
― Server-Side Request Forgery (SSRF)
SSRF vulnerabilities allow attackers to manipulate server-side requests and access internal infrastructure.
Cloud-native applications and API-driven architectures are particularly vulnerable to SSRF exploitation.
Strict request validation and network segmentation help reduce these risks.
The owasp top 10 2025 highlights the importance of proactive security integration across development, deployment, and operational workflows.
Developer Infotech builds secure enterprise applications using modern Web Development, Laravel Development, AI Solutions, and cloud-native security engineering practices designed for modern cybersecurity challenges.
Authentication & Authorization
Authentication and authorization systems form the foundation of modern web application security.
Authentication verifies user identity, while authorization determines access permissions within systems and applications.
Strong authentication strategies are essential for protecting enterprise platforms, ecommerce applications, SaaS systems, and cloud-native infrastructures.
Modern applications should implement multi-factor authentication (MFA) to reduce credential compromise risks significantly.
Password-based authentication alone is no longer sufficient for modern cybersecurity requirements.
Secure password storage using hashing algorithms such as bcrypt or Argon2 helps protect user credentials against data breaches.
Applications should also enforce strong password policies and account lockout protections.
Session management is another critical component of secure authentication systems.
Improper session handling can expose users to hijacking attacks and unauthorized access.
Secure cookies, token expiration policies, and encrypted session storage improve overall security posture.
Role-based access control (RBAC) helps organizations manage authorization efficiently.
Users should only access systems and resources necessary for their specific responsibilities.
Modern web security best practices emphasize least privilege access models across enterprise systems.
Single Sign-On (SSO) integration is also increasingly common across enterprise ecosystems.
SSO improves user convenience while centralizing authentication management and security controls.
Developer Infotech helps businesses implement secure authentication architectures through scalable backend systems, API security integration, cloud-native identity management, and enterprise-grade authorization workflows.
Data Protection
Data protection remains one of the most important aspects of modern cybersecurity for businesses.
Organizations collect and process large volumes of customer information, financial records, operational data, and sensitive enterprise assets.
Strong encryption practices help protect data both in transit and at rest.
Applications should enforce HTTPS using TLS encryption across all communications.
Sensitive databases and storage systems should also use encryption to reduce exposure risks during breaches.
Backup security is another critical requirement.
Organizations must secure backup systems against ransomware attacks and unauthorized access.
Modern cloud infrastructures should implement automated encrypted backups with disaster recovery capabilities.
Data minimization also improves overall security posture.
Applications should only collect and retain information necessary for operational requirements.
Secure deletion policies help reduce long-term data exposure risks.
Modern cybersecurity for businesses also emphasizes privacy compliance and customer trust protection.
Developer Infotech helps organizations implement secure cloud infrastructure, encrypted storage systems, secure APIs, and enterprise-grade data protection architectures optimized for modern regulatory and security requirements.
Input Validation & Sanitization
Improper input handling remains one of the leading causes of web application vulnerabilities.
Applications must validate and sanitize all user input before processing or storing data.
Input validation helps prevent SQL injection, cross-site scripting (XSS), command injection, and malicious file upload attacks.
Server-side validation is especially important because client-side validation alone can be bypassed easily.
Applications should validate data types, length restrictions, file formats, and acceptable input ranges consistently.
Output encoding also plays a major role in preventing cross-site scripting attacks.
Modern secure coding practices emphasize centralized validation frameworks, parameterized queries, and ORM-based database interactions.
Developer Infotech builds secure web platforms using advanced input validation systems, secure backend architectures, and enterprise-grade security engineering methodologies.
Security Headers Configuration
Security headers provide an additional layer of browser-based protection for modern web applications.
Content Security Policy (CSP) helps reduce cross-site scripting risks by restricting allowed resource execution sources.
HTTP Strict Transport Security (HSTS) enforces secure HTTPS connections between browsers and applications.
X-Frame-Options helps prevent clickjacking attacks by controlling iframe embedding behavior.
X-Content-Type-Options prevents MIME-type confusion attacks that exploit improper file interpretation.
Referrer-Policy controls how referral information is shared across external requests.
Modern web security best practices recommend implementing security headers consistently across all applications, APIs, and cloud services.
Developer Infotech helps businesses configure secure web infrastructures with optimized security headers, cloud protection systems, and enterprise-grade cybersecurity implementation strategies.
API Security
Modern applications rely heavily on APIs for frontend integration, mobile app connectivity, cloud services, and third-party communication.
API security has become a major focus area in modern cybersecurity strategies.
Authentication tokens, API gateways, and rate limiting mechanisms help protect APIs against unauthorized access and abuse.
Input validation is especially important for APIs because attackers frequently target exposed endpoints with automated attacks.
Organizations should also implement API monitoring systems capable of detecting unusual traffic patterns and malicious requests.
Secure API development requires encryption, authentication validation, schema enforcement, and access control integration.
Modern secure coding practices also emphasize API version management and dependency security.
Developer Infotech builds secure API ecosystems optimized for scalable enterprise systems, SaaS platforms, ecommerce infrastructures, and mobile application environments.
Security Testing
Security testing helps organizations identify vulnerabilities before attackers exploit them.
Modern web applications should integrate continuous security testing throughout development and deployment workflows.
Penetration testing simulates real-world attacks to identify exploitable weaknesses.
Static Application Security Testing (SAST) analyzes source code for security flaws during development.
Dynamic Application Security Testing (DAST) evaluates running applications for vulnerabilities in production-like environments.
Dependency scanning identifies outdated libraries and vulnerable third-party components.
Modern DevSecOps workflows integrate automated security validation directly into CI/CD pipelines.
Comprehensive web application security checklist 2025 strategies rely heavily on continuous security testing and proactive vulnerability management.
Developer Infotech implements scalable security testing systems for enterprise applications, ecommerce platforms, APIs, and cloud-native digital ecosystems.
Incident Response Plan
Even highly secure systems may eventually face security incidents.
Organizations must prepare structured incident response plans to minimize operational disruption and financial damage.
A strong incident response strategy includes:
- Threat detection
- Incident containment
- System recovery
- Forensic investigation
- Stakeholder communication
Security teams should establish clear escalation procedures and recovery responsibilities before incidents occur.
Regular simulation exercises help organizations improve response readiness and operational resilience.
Modern cybersecurity for businesses requires proactive preparation rather than reactive crisis management.
Developer Infotech helps organizations build scalable incident response frameworks with cloud monitoring, threat detection, and enterprise recovery strategies.
Compliance Requirements
Modern businesses must comply with increasing cybersecurity and data protection regulations.
Compliance frameworks such as GDPR, HIPAA, PCI-DSS, and SOC 2 require organizations to implement strong security controls and privacy protections.
Failure to meet compliance standards can result in financial penalties, operational disruption, and reputational damage.
Organizations should regularly audit security practices, access controls, data protection systems, and infrastructure configurations.
Compliance is no longer just a legal requirement — it has become a critical part of customer trust and enterprise risk management.
Developer Infotech helps businesses implement secure and compliant digital infrastructures through scalable cybersecurity architectures, cloud-native security engineering, and enterprise-grade application development practices.